360 Huntington Ave., Boston, Massachusetts 02115 | 617.373.2000 | TTY 617.373.3768 | Emergency Information© 2019  Northeastern University | MyNortheastern. Closely related to physics and engineering, students who want to understand how things work and apply that knowledge to build something new could thrive in a computer engineering program. This course will cover the basics of physical phenomena including particles, work, gravitation and motion. Computer engineering graduates may get jobs working with telecommunications systems and devices, robotics, aerospace technology, and many other technologies. Computer scientists typically have an understanding of: Some common skills a computer engineer utilize include: The technology industry is booming with growth and opportunity. It is a field that combines physics, electrical engineering and computer science. MastersInDataScience.org is owned and operated by 2U, Inc. © 2U, Inc. 2020, About 2U | Privacy Policy | Terms of Use | Resources, 23 Great Schools with Master’s Programs in Data Science, 22 Top Schools with Master’s in Information Systems Degrees, 25 Top Schools with Master’s in Business Analytics Programs, Online Masters in Business Analytics Programs, Online Masters in Information Systems Programs, Data Science Certificate Programs for 2021, Your Guide for Online Data Science Courses in 2021. As a field that is closely aligned with mathematics, computer science applies theoretical ideas to solve real world problems. Computer science degrees also vary depending on the school you attend and your willingness to relocate. A degree in computer engineering, on the other hand, focuses on physics, electronics and computer architecture. Some of today’s most in-demand disciplines—ready for you to plug into anytime, anywhere with the Professional Advancement Network. In fact, computer science jobs are now the, What’s more, qualified computer science professionals are in high demand. Computer Science & Engineering (CSE) is an academic program at many universities which comprises scientific and engineering aspects of computing. Working in computer science or engineering requires an in-depth understanding of technical concepts. Public Health Careers: What Can You Do With a Master’s Degree? These programs also share many of the same prerequisites and coursework. If we consider computing technology in terms of scale, Computer Engineers operate often at the microscopic and macroscopic ends of the spectrum, whereas Computer Scientists work in the middle parts of the spectrum. Computer engineers are involved in many aspects of computing, from circuit design to the design of microcontrollers, microprocessors, personal computers and supercomputers. If you don’t like abstract work and prefer working with tangible things then computer engineering is likely more your style. */. This course provides students with the tools and skills to apply statistical methods to large datasets using computational methods. , for example, allows students to specialize in database management, security, game design, graphics, or programming languages. Computer science degree programs require courses including analysis of algorithms, operating system principles, computer architecture and software engineering, so an interest in math, puzzles, and problem solving would suit a student well. Computer engineers research how to build all varieties of computing systems from smartphones to integrated circuits. Computer science degree programs require courses including analysis of algorithms, operating system principles, computer architecture and software engineering, so an interest in math, puzzles, and problem solving would suit a student well. The Bureau of Labor Statistics. Courses in a computer science degree focus on the theory of computation, languages and environments. Through this course students learn to write code that is optimized for its use case and analyze the efficiency of code. The VR/AR industry is predicted to be a $9.9 billion field by 2022 and has seen a 93 percent increase in job demand in the past year. . It is an integration of computer science and electrical engineering. There are many different career options for computer engineers, such as: aerospace, life sciences, mobile devices and robotics. Both computer science and computer engineering use computers in order to solve problems using data and human interaction. If you are at the start of your career, however, deciding whether to pursue computer science vs computer engineering can be challenging. Computer Engineering vs Computer Science: Skills. programming languages such as Java, SQL, and Python; how to run, maintain, and fix Linux and Windows operating systems; knowledge of designing, coding, and testing software; how computer networks work and how to manage them. This field also focuses on how to create algorithms that efficiently achieve complex tasks, whether that task is emulating a human brain or determining the best route for your Uber pool. Careers in computer and information science are predicted to grow 19 percent by 2026, and computer hardware engineer jobs are expected to increase 5 percent in the same timeframe. Computer science vs. engineering: Education requirements. In addition, differing terminology is often used between schools. In many situations computer scientist and computer engineer work side-by-side to design, maintain and build computers, software and hardware. There are many different career options for computer engineers, such as: aerospace, life sciences, mobile devices and robotics. Students will learn to design and build the type of circuits used in computing systems. Careers in computer and information science are predicted to, , and computer hardware engineer jobs are expected to increase, The salary for both computer scientists and computer engineers is also highly attractive for prospective professionals. Other booming fields that are hiring both computer scientists and engineers are the artificial intelligence (AI) and the virtual reality (VR)/augmented reality (AR) industries. Some potential job titles for graduates with a degree in computer science include software developer, database administrator, web developer, or project manager. Some schools even combine these two fields into one department or major. Computer engineering focuses on solving problems and … At Northeastern, faculty and students collaborate in our more than 30 federally funded research centers, tackling some of the biggest challenges in health, security, and sustainability. Computer science focuses mostly on troubleshooting issues on a software level. These fields all rely heavily on a good understanding of the theory of computation and the ability to apply this knowledge to real-world problems. Any electronic device you use from your laptop to your car has been developed and designed by a combination of computer scientists and computer engineers. Computer engineers are also needed to program and engineer the hardware of AI machines. In-Demand Biotechnology Careers Shaping Our Future, The Benefits of Online Learning: 7 Advantages of Online Degrees, How to Write a Statement of Purpose for Graduate School, Online Learning Tips, Strategies & Advice, How to Stay Updated on Regulatory Changes, 360 Huntington Ave., Boston, Massachusetts 02115. Computer engineers are also needed to program and engineer the hardware of AI machines. The Align program allows you to pivot your college experience and discover new, amazing opportunities. The technology industry is booming with growth and opportunity. Computer engineers are involved in many aspects of computing, from circuit design to the design of microcontrollers, microprocessors, personal computers and supercomputers. These techniques help describe and predict many natural and physical phenomena. With Northeastern University’s unique Align Master’s program in Computer Science, students bridge the gap between their current know-how and what they need to succeed in the tech world. But if you’re looking at computer science vs. computer engineering when it comes to landing a job as a programmer, a degree in computer science is probably your best bet. Some of the most popular careers for computer scientists are software engineering, UI/UX design, web design, data science, and machine learning. The majority of these jobs require skills and knowledge gained through an advanced degree in computer science or computer engineering. Both Computer Engineers and Computer Scientists advance computing technology and solve problems using computing technology. To create the best possible devices businesses need highly skilled employees in both of these areas. They are more likely to spend more time at a lab bench than writing code. When weighing these programs, consider your preferences and inclinations. As a field that is closely aligned with mathematics. These two fields work in tandem to create the products we use everyday. Your computer engineering degrees will most likely cover a wide array of topics including computer architecture, computer networks and physics. This course covers the way operating systems manage and execute code in order make software run. Completing a master’s degree in computer science can give you a competitive edge in your current job or allow you to switch career fields. Computer engineering focuses on how to build devices.